description Ghanaian Times press article: The Minister of Fisheries and Aquaculture Development (MOFAD), Mrs Mavis HawaKoomson, yesterday launched the “Resilient Aquatic Food Systems” initiative in Accra. Aimed at contributing to the country’s food security as well as its developmental agenda, the initiative proposes the integration of aquatic production into water resources management plans to support the country’s food production systems.
